Motorcyclist killed in A83 crash
A woman has died following a crash on the A83, Inveraray to Arrochar Road in Argyll.
The 42-year-old motorcyclist was riding a Kawasaki cycle northbound on the A83 when she collided with a Renault Clio car, travelling the opposite way.
The collision happened at about 1045 BST near to the Loch Fyne Oyster Bar. The woman died at the scene.
The 73-year-old driver of the car was uninjured. A report will be sent to the procurator fiscal.
